Medal Count's dam was a confirmed sprinter, who handled both surfaces. He's also a half sib to a horse who broke it's maiden impressively going 4.5 furlongs at Keeneland for Pletcher. She actually beat Rachel Alexandra in the 6f Debutante at Churchill Downs early on in her 2yo season. She ran a 6 Beyer when they tried to stretch her out.

Obviously, Medal Count gets a huge boost, in stamina, from being sired by Dynaformer, but he's the most glamorous name of any sire in the race.

Dale Romans is a beast on these big days at Churchill. He's pulled off some crazy upsets. A decrepit Court Vision winning the BC Mile off of lousy Dutrow Jr. form. Sassy Image was another who won a big stake despite being my first throwout in the race. Little Mike looked like Lure on the Derby undercard. His record is just great on the biggest days at CD. That's the only thing I respect about Medal Count.
